FRANKFURT — Ford is recalling about 322,000 cars in Europe because the batteries could potentially catch fire due to acid leakage. The recall affects Mondeo, S-Max and Galaxy vehicles built between February 2014 and February 2019, a Ford spokesman told Automotive News Europe. SEOUL — South Korea’s Hyundai Motor Group and auto technology supplier Aptiv said on Monday they are creating a 50-50 autonomous driving joint venture valued at $4 billion. In the grand scheme of automotive history, Koenigsegg hasn’t been around for very long. Founded in 1994 by Christian von Koenigsegg, its mission has been simple: make some of the fastest, most ferocious cars the world has ever seen. As the UAW strike against General Motors Co. nears a second week, the issues in dispute are similar to those that sparked strikes in the past: health care, wages and the company’s commitment to invest in U.S. facilities. Eight projects in seven states received funding to advance research and testing of autonomous vehicle technology as part of a U.S. Department of Transportation grant program, the department said Wednesday. The Automated Driving System Demonstration Grants were established with about $60 million available to test integration of automated driving systems, according to the DOT. Over

Toyota is pushing ahead with its plan to boost efficiencies in the production of its midsize Tacoma and full-size Tundra pickups, which are moving onto a common platform, with a $391 million investment in its pickup plant near San Antonio.
